Online tech communities, such as Reddit's r/techsupport, are digital platforms where users can seek assistance, share knowledge, and discuss topics related to technology, hardware, software issues, and troubleshooting. These communities foster collaborative problem-solving, peer-to-peer support, and the dissemination of tech-related information across a diverse user base.
Key Features
- Community-driven Q&A and discussion threads
- Wide range of technical topics and subforums
- User reputation systems promoting helpful contributions
- Real-time interactions and comment sections
- Accessibility for both beginners and experts
Pros
- Provides quick access to diverse technical expertise
- Encourages collaborative learning and peer support
- Free resource for troubleshooting and advice
- Active communities with ongoing discussions
- Accessible to users worldwide at any time
Cons
- Variable quality of advice depending on contributors
- Potential for misleading or incorrect information
- Risk of unhelpful or toxic interactions if moderation is weak
- Information overload for newcomers unfamiliar with community norms
- Dependence on community knowledge which may be inconsistent
